A ring light is a circular lighting tool that provides even, shadow-free illumination for photography, videography, makeup application, and live streaming. Its unique design places the light source around the camera lens, creating a flattering catchlight in the subject's eyes and eliminating harsh shadows. Whether you are a content creator, a professional photographer, or a makeup artist, a ring light is an essential piece of equipment for achieving professional-quality lighting. 1、best ring light for video

When searching for the best ring light for video, several critical factors come into play to ensure your footage looks professional and polished. First, consider the size of the ring light. For video content, a larger diameter ring light, typically between 14 to 18 inches, is often preferred because it provides a broader, softer light that reduces harsh shadows and creates a more even illumination across your face and background. The larger the ring, the more diffused and flattering the light becomes, which is essential for talking head videos, tutorials, or interviews. Second, look for adjustable color temperature. The best ring lights for video offer a range from warm (3200K) to cool (5600K) light, allowing you to match the ambient lighting in your room or create a specific mood. This flexibility is crucial for maintaining consistent skin tones and avoiding color casts. Third, brightness levels matter. You need a ring light with dimmable brightness, preferably with stepless adjustment, so you can fine-tune the intensity for different shooting environments. A ring light with high CRI (Color Rendering Index) of 95 or above is also vital because it ensures colors appear natural and accurate on camera, which is especially important for product reviews or beauty content. Fourth, consider the mounting and stand options. The best ring lights come with sturdy, adjustable tripod stands that can be positioned at various heights and angles. Some models also include a phone holder or a camera mount, making them versatile for different devices. Finally, think about additional features like remote control or Bluetooth connectivity, which allow you to adjust settings without touching the light during recording. Popular models like the Neewer 18-inch ring light or the Godox LED ring light are frequently recommended for video creators due to their reliable performance and build quality. Ultimately, the best ring light for video is one that combines size, color temperature control, brightness adjustability, and high CRI to deliver consistent, professional lighting that enhances your video production value.

2、ring light for photography

For photographers, a ring light is a versatile tool that can dramatically improve image quality, especially in portrait, macro, and product photography. In portrait photography, the ring light creates a distinctive catchlight in the subject's eyes, giving them a lively, engaging appearance that is highly sought after in fashion and beauty shots. The circular reflection adds depth and sparkle, making the eyes the focal point of the image. Additionally, because the light is evenly distributed around the lens, it eliminates harsh shadows under the chin, nose, and cheekbones, resulting in a soft, flattering look that minimizes imperfections. For macro photography, a ring light is invaluable because it provides close-up, shadow-free illumination of small subjects like flowers, insects, or jewelry. The light wraps around the lens, ensuring that even the tiniest details are well-lit and sharp. Many macro ring lights are designed to attach directly to the camera lens, providing consistent light at very close distances. In product photography, a ring light helps to create clean, even lighting that reduces reflections and highlights textures accurately. This is particularly useful for e-commerce images where clarity and color accuracy are paramount. When choosing a ring light for photography, consider the light's CRI rating; a high CRI of 95 or above ensures that colors are reproduced faithfully, which is critical for product shots. Also, think about the power source: some ring lights are battery-powered for portability, while others plug into AC power for longer sessions. The ability to adjust both brightness and color temperature is also beneficial because it allows you to adapt to different shooting conditions. For example, a studio photographer might prefer a larger, more powerful ring light, while a travel photographer might opt for a compact, battery-operated version. Overall, the ring light is a must-have accessory for any photographer looking to achieve consistent, professional lighting across various genres.

3、ring light for makeup

Makeup artists and beauty enthusiasts have long recognized the ring light as an essential tool for achieving flawless makeup application and stunning selfies. The primary benefit of using a ring light for makeup is its ability to provide even, shadow-free lighting that mimics natural daylight. This is crucial because uneven lighting can cause you to apply makeup too heavily or miss spots, leading to an unnatural look in real life or on camera. With a ring light, you can see every detail of your face clearly, ensuring that foundation is blended seamlessly, eyeshadow is applied evenly, and contouring is precise. The circular design of the ring light is also responsible for creating the iconic "ring light eyes" effect, where the light reflects in your eyes, making them appear larger, brighter, and more captivating. This effect is especially popular in makeup tutorials on social media platforms like Instagram and YouTube, where a polished, high-end look is desired. When selecting a ring light for makeup, look for features like adjustable color temperature, which allows you to switch between warm and cool light to match different environments or skin tones. Many makeup artists prefer a light that can be dimmed, so they can control the intensity without washing out their subject's features. The size of the ring light also matters: a smaller ring light (10 to 12 inches) is often sufficient for close-up makeup work and is easier to transport, while a larger ring light (14 to 18 inches) provides broader coverage for full-face shots. Additionally, consider a ring light with a built-in mirror or a phone holder, which makes it easier to apply makeup while looking directly at the light. Some advanced models even offer color-changing RGB modes for creative effects, though for standard makeup application, a simple bi-color LED ring light is usually the best choice. Brands like Lume Cube and Rifa are popular among makeup artists for their portability and quality. In summary, a ring light is an indispensable tool for anyone serious about makeup, providing the consistent, flattering lighting needed for perfect application and stunning visual content.

4、LED ring light

The LED ring light has become the standard choice for modern lighting due to its energy efficiency, longevity, and versatility. Unlike traditional incandescent or fluorescent lights, LED ring lights produce very little heat, making them comfortable to use for extended periods, especially during makeup application or long video shoots. They also consume significantly less power, which is beneficial for both battery-operated and plug-in models. One of the key advantages of LED ring lights is their adjustable color temperature, which typically ranges from 3200K (warm yellow) to 5600K (cool daylight). This allows users to match the lighting to their environment or create a specific mood, whether it's a cozy vlog setup or a bright, professional studio look. Many LED ring lights also offer stepless dimming, giving you precise control over brightness levels from 1% to 100%. This is particularly useful for fine-tuning the light to avoid overexposure or harsh shadows. Another important feature of LED ring lights is their high Color Rendering Index (CRI). A CRI of 95 or above ensures that colors appear natural and vibrant, which is critical for photography, videography, and makeup application. Low-CRI lights can make skin tones look dull or greenish, so always check the CRI rating before purchasing. LED ring lights come in various sizes, from small 6-inch models designed for smartphone use to large 18-inch or even 24-inch versions for professional studios. The larger the LED ring light, the softer and more diffused the light output, which is ideal for portraits and video. Many LED ring lights also include multiple lighting modes, such as ring light only, side lights, or full surface lighting, providing additional creative flexibility. The durability of LED lights is another benefit: they can last for tens of thousands of hours without significant degradation in brightness or color accuracy. When shopping for an LED ring light, consider the build quality, the stability of the stand, and the warranty offered by the manufacturer. Popular brands like Neewer, Godox, and Lume Cube offer reliable LED ring lights that cater to both beginners and professionals. In conclusion, the LED ring light is a superior lighting solution that combines efficiency, flexibility, and quality, making it the top choice for content creators, photographers, and makeup artists alike.

5、ring light for streaming

For live streamers, a ring light is one of the most important investments you can make to elevate the quality of your broadcast. Good lighting is often the difference between a professional-looking stream and one that appears amateurish. A ring light for streaming provides even, flattering illumination that reduces shadows on your face, making you look more vibrant and engaging to your audience. The circular design creates a beautiful catchlight in your eyes, which helps to establish a connection with viewers and keeps them focused on you. When choosing a ring light for streaming, size is a key consideration. A larger ring light, such as a 14-inch or 18-inch model, is generally recommended because it provides a broader light source that softens shadows and creates a more natural look. It also allows you to position the light further away from your face while still achieving even coverage. Adjustable color temperature is another critical feature for streamers. Being able to switch between warm and cool light helps you match your room's ambient lighting or the theme of your stream. For example, a cool white light might be ideal for a tech or gaming stream, while a warmer tone can create a cozy, inviting atmosphere for chatting or creative streams. Dimmable brightness is equally important because it allows you to control the intensity of the light. Too much light can wash out your features or cause glare on glasses, while too little light can make you look dull. Many ring lights for streaming come with a remote control or a smartphone app, enabling you to adjust settings without interrupting your stream. Additionally, consider the mounting options: a sturdy tripod stand with adjustable height is essential, and some ring lights include a phone holder or a camera mount, making them compatible with various setups. Some advanced ring lights also feature RGB color modes, allowing you to add colored backlighting or accent lights to your stream for a more dynamic visual experience. For streamers who use a green screen, a ring light with adjustable brightness and color temperature can help achieve even lighting that reduces shadows and makes chroma keying easier. Brands like Elgato, Neewer, and Razer offer ring lights specifically designed for streaming, with features like built-in diffusers and multi-device compatibility. In summary, a ring light is a game-changer for streaming, providing the consistent, professional lighting that helps you stand out and connect with your audience.
